[pso] [tema2] Sincronizare

Razvan Deaconescu razvan.deaconescu at cs.pub.ro
Fri Apr 10 10:13:59 EEST 2009


On Wed, 2009-04-08 at 03:17 -0700, Vlad Albulescu wrote:
> Este ok daca in loc de sincronizare am facut ca dispozitivul sa nu
> suporte mai multe deschideri simultane? (-EBUSY la open() la
> urmatoarele)
> Am ales abordarea asta pentru ca fiind vorba de o seriala,
> intercalarea fluxurilor de octeti de la doua procese ar fi oricum a
> bad idea.
> In contextul in care cel mult un proces are dispozitivul deschis at
> any time, write/read si ISR-ul se sincronizeaza cu variabila aceea
> atomica si lucreaza in parti diferite ale bufferelor, si n-ar trebui
> sa fie o problema.

E OK.

Razvan

[1] http://cursuri.cs.pub.ro/pipermail/pso/2005-March/000726.html



More information about the pso mailing list